RPI Reports: The Predicted Oil Production Decline Will Boost the Sidetracking Market

The sidetracking (ST) market is one of the most important segments of the Russian oilfield services market (OSM); in 2017, its share in the total OSM volume was 8.7%. In the past ten years, this segment has been on the rise, demonstrating a remarkable growth rate. This operation has become …

RPI: Horizontal Drilling in Russia

Horizontal drilling increased by 80% in both KMAD and East Siberia between 2007-2012. The contribution to incremental drilling was roughly the same in both regions.
